The Art and Science of Dog Running

Dogs have a natural instinct to run. This inherent activity is not only beneficial for their physical health but also plays a significant role in mental well-being. Through structured dog training, pet owners can maximize the benefits of dog running. Training ensures that dogs are not only running efficiently but also safely, preventing injuries or overheating.

Essential Tips for Effective Dog Training

Before embarking on a new running routine, establishing a groundwork of basic commands and discipline is essential. Effective dog training should start with commands like “sit,” “stay,” and “come,” which ensure that your pet responds to you during runs. Additionally, integrating short sprints with slow-paced jogging can offer diversity and keep the activity engaging for your dog.

The Role of Dog Treadmills in Modern Exercise Regimens

As much as outdoor dog running offers an ideal scenario for exercise, there are times when it’s just not practical. Extreme weather conditions, busy schedules, or unsafe environments can deter outdoor activities. Enter dog treadmills—an excellent indoor alternative. These innovative devices offer a controlled environment where speed, time, and intensity can be tailored to suit the individual needs of your pet.

Much like their human counterparts, dog treadmills are designed to simulate the outdoor running experience. They provide consistent exercise opportunities regardless of external factors, helping dogs to maintain their routine without interference. Furthermore, for pets recovering from injuries, dog treadmills offer a softer surface that reduces the risk of re-injury while allowing gradual reintroduction to physical activity.
